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A damp, moldy smell is a red flag. It means there’s moisture in your home. You might not see the leak, but the smell is there. This is a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it. You could be dealing with mold. That’s a health risk. We’ll find the leak and fix it before it gets worse.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Dark spots or discoloration on ceilings or walls are a sign of water damage. These can come from a pinhole leak. You might not see the source, but the damage is there. It’s a warning that water is spreading. We’ll use tools to find the leak. We’ll fix it before the damage gets worse.

High Water Bills Without a Clear Reason

If your water bill goes up and you can’t find the cause, a leak might be to blame. Pinhole leaks can go unnoticed for a long time. They waste water and increase your bill. You don’t have to accept it. We’ll check your system and find the problem. We’ll fix it and save you money.

Warped or Buckling Flooring

Wood or laminate floors can warp or buckle from water damage. This is a sign that water has been underneath. It’s a serious issue. The longer it stays, the more damage it causes. We’ll inspect the area and remove the water. We’ll dry it out and prevent further damage.

Warm Spots on the Floor

A warm patch on the floor might mean there’s water under it. This can happen if a pipe is leaking. It’s a sign of hidden damage. You might not see the leak, but the heat is a clue. We’ll check the area and find the source. We’ll fix it before it causes more harm.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ost In Deary, ID

Costs for Pinhole Leak Water Removal vary depending on the damage. You might pay between $500 and $2,500. It depends on how much water is there, how long it’s been there, and how much damage is done. The size of your home and the location of the leak also matter. Some cases are faster and cheaper. Others take more time and effort. It’s best to get an on-site assessment for an accurate estimate.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ial inspection and assessment $100 – $300 Size of the affected area and complexity of the leak.
Water extraction and removal $200 – $600 Amount of water and how quickly it’s removed.
Drying and dehumidification $300 – $1,000 Time needed to dry the area and moisture levels.
Mold inspection and removal $200 – $700 Extent of mold growth and cleanup needed.
Final inspection and repair $100 – $400 More work needed after drying is complete.
Emergency response fee $150 – $500 Time of day and urgency of the situation.
